Some 2.4 Bits: No More Diminshing Returns for Honor and Some Class Cha
February 1st, 2008 by Magog ·
1 Comment »
Looks like they are prepping for 2.4 on the test realm shortly… there’s been a flurry of blue posts with some actual 2.4 info. Big news of the day? The removal of diminishing returns from honor kills:
“We’ve reached a point where we’re now confident that applying diminishing returns to honor is no longer necessary, and we’re currently planning to remove it with the 2.4 patch.
With this change we’re including a few restrictions as well though: Players that have the resurrection sickness debuff will not be worth any honor, and if a player dies 50 times or more during a battleground they won’t be worth any honor for the remainder of that battle.” -Vaneck
It’s about time. Anything to relieve the honor grind is a welcome sight.
Also, some of the class changes that have been leaked by blue have PvP ramifications: priests will now be able to use Fear Ward while in Shadowform and shaman will get some Earth Shield relief as the Healing Grace talent will now grant 10/20/30% dispel resists.
More info to come as they release the full patch notes.

Personal Ratings Bug; BG9 5v5 Tournament
February 1st, 2008 by Magog ·
2 Comments
In the “first step is admitting that you have a problem” category, Blizzard has finally announced that there are issues with /teamquit. Although now that personal ratings are involved, it has become a more sticky situation:
“An issue has been identified that is sometimes causing players to be removed from the wrong Arena Team when attempting to leave a different team (being removed from the 5v5 team when trying to leave the 2v2 team, for example).
As a direct result of this some players are inadvertently losing some of their personal rating.
We expect this issue to be resolved in an upcoming patch, but we regret to inform you that our support teams will be unable to reimburse any lost ratings during this time.” -Tharfor
BG9 5v5 Invitational Tournament
On the heels of their EU Cyclone Tournament, SK Gaming is now behind the newly announced Battlegroup 9 5v5 Invitational Tournament. Top teams such as CLC and Shuttlecocks have already committed.
This will be an 8 team double-elimination tournament, best of five games format. Seeds will be given out according to rank and rating of the current arena season and past accomplishments. Sign-ups begin today (Jan 31) and will end February 5th, brackets and teams will be announced by February 6th.
Although some may be miffed at the “BG9″, “8 team”, and “invitational” qualifiers to this tournament, it’s a good start. At the very least, we will get to see some high quality 5v5 matches. And hopefully this will just be a sign of things to come as tournaments should be open to more entrants/teams when tournament servers are finally available from Blizzard.
